About Our School

All schools in the Washington Elementary School District are committed to achieving excellence for every child, every day, every opportunity. Moon Mountain Elementary School's curriculum is fully aligned with State Standards. Moon Mountain, which is a preschool through sixth grade facility, offers students a learning environment rich with differentiated instruction through the used of Multiple Intelligences strategies. A strong school-wide citizenship program also helps students build a sense of personal responsibility for safe learning environment. Moon Mountain is also a location for Washington District special needs programs. We meet the needs of emotionally and learning disabled students as well as special needs preschoolers. This school is focused on high expectations regarding academics, behavior and motivation for all students. Moon Mountain  provides art, music and PE for all grade levels.

Junior High & High School
Moon Mountain students attend Mountain Sky Junior High and Thunderbird High School.
Site Council Membership
Council CompositionSite Councils function as school-based leadership groups. They are charged with the responsibility of ensuring that individuals who are affected by the outcome of a decision at the school site have an opportunity to provide input into the decision-making process as mandated by Arizona Revised Statute 15-351.


Meeting DatesMoon Mountain Site Council meets the second Tuesday of each month at 5:00 p.m.
